WHAT IS SOCIAL MEDIA ADVERTISING?

Any paid marketing campaign on social media is referred to as social media advertising. These advertisements target particular audiences according to their demographics, interests, and actions. Brands may reach both potential and existing customers with customized promotions through advertisements. Key elements of social media advertising include:

1. Ad Content : This can include written content, photos, videos, and other multimedia components intended to draw viewers in and deliver a message.

2. Targeting : To make sure the right people see your ads, you can specify particular demographics, interests, and behaviors using social media advertising.

3. Ad Placement : Depending on the social media platform, you can select where your ads show up in users’ news feeds, stories, and other areas.

4. Budget and Bidding : For their campaigns, advertisers set a budget and select from a range of bidding options, including cost per click (CPC) and cost per impression  (CPM).

5. Metrics and Analytics : Details about an advertisement’s performance, such as click-through rates, conversion rates, and return on investment, are provided by social media advertising.

HOW SOCIAL MEDIA ADVERTISING DIFFERS FROM ORGANIC CONTENT?

Social Media and Organic Content on social media platforms differ in several key ways:

1. Paid vs. Free : The primary distinction is that organic content is the unpaid, unsponsored content that people and businesses post on their social media profiles, whereas paid content is what social media advertisers pay to promote their posts or run ads.

2. Reach and Visibility :

  • Social Media Advertising: Advertisers can swiftly reach a more specialized and larger audience by using paid content. To make sure that a particular demographic, set of interests, or set of behaviors sees their content, advertisers can employ precise targeting options.
  • Organic Content: The platform’s algorithms control organic posts, so their audience size may be limited. The size of your following, timing, and other variables all affect how visible your organic content is.

3. Speed and Control :

  • Social Media Advertising: More control is now given to advertisers over who can see and when their content is displayed. They can also schedule and set budgets for advertising campaigns.
  • Organic Content: Although organic posts are more instantaneous and can be published right away, their visibility depends on user interaction and sharing.

4. Ad Formats:

  • Social Media Advertising: There are numerous ad formats and placements available to advertisers, such as carousel ads, video ads, sponsored posts, and more. These formats are intended to achieve particular marketing objectives and can be very attractive.
  • Organic Content: Generally speaking, organic posts are restricted to the text, image, video, and story post types that are standard on the platform.

5. Targeting:

  • Social Media Advertising: To target a particular audience based on their demographics, interests, behavior, and other factors, advertisers can leverage advanced targeting options. This accuracy may produce better outcomes.
  • Organic Content: Less targeted, organic content is mainly shared with your current followers and their connections.

6. Cost:

  • Social Media Advertising: Involves a price as ad spots are paid for by advertisers. A few examples of these variables include targeting, competition, and ad placement.
  • Organic Content: Is free to share and upload, but producing interesting, high-quality material might take some time.

7. Measurements and Analytics:

  • Social Media Advertising: Provides in-depth information on ad performance metrics, such as ROI, clicks, impressions, and conversions.
  • Organic Content: Gives access to more restricted data, usually focused on engagement metrics such as shares, likes, and comments.

BENEFITS OF SOCIAL MEDIA ADVERTISING

Naturally, marketers must exercise caution when selecting their techniques. In situations when funds are limited or ROI needs to be demonstrated, this is especially valid. The main arguments in favor of advertisements for brands are listed below.

  • Advertisements enable brands to extract more value from their natural presence.You are not alone if you believe that the reach of your social media postings has decreased recently.Most companies these days suffer from declining organic reach, particularly on Facebook and Instagram.Whether you like it or not, sponsored material is receiving more space on social media than organic content. Reduced organic reach is the result of more firms engaging in sponsored social media.Companies ought to see this as an opportunity to get more mileage out of their natural social media presence. Your paid campaigns can be directly impacted by and optimized by the things you do naturally.For instance, think about building an advertising campaign on your finest organic content. Boosting high-performing posts and using influencer content for advertisements is now simpler than ever.
  • Raise awareness among groups of people you would not have otherwiseIt’s difficult to engage with new audiences when there is a lack of organic reach.The same is true for earlier customers and followers. Ultimately, there’s no assurance that your organic material will be seen by anybody, not even your fans.This is when advertisements come in handy. Advertising on social media nowadays enables marketers to hyper-target people according to predetermined criteria. This comprises

– Leads and prospects who have viewed your website
– Clientele that you have previously served
– Potential new clients that fit the target market for your brand.

  • Acquire important data about your audience and brand quickly.For companies, the complexity of contemporary ad analytics may be intimidating.However, the insights you gain from your campaigns might be a treasure trove of marketing information. The effectiveness of various ad creatives, offers, CTAs, and other elements may be measured through advertisements.The information acquired from these efforts is based on actual individuals, not conjecture. If you want to understand more about your clients, even a small-scale test might provide insightful results. Consider advertisements as a scalable method of gathering market data.
